Abstract

The invention discloses an efficient drying device for a capacitor housing and relates to the field of capacitor production. The efficient drying device comprises a box body and a funnel, wherein theupper half part of the box body is connected with a heat transfer mechanism; rectangular holes are arranged in the middle positions at the left side and the right side of the box body and are connected with a swing mechanism in a sliding manner; the swing mechanism is fixedly connected with a vibration mechanism; and the funnel is fixedly connected to the bottom of an inner cavity of the box body.By adopting the efficient drying device for the capacitor housing, simultaneous drying and vibrating, and up-and-down swinging during vibrating can be achieved through adding the swing mechanism andthe vibration mechanism into the drying device when the capacitor housing is dried, so that the capacitor housing can be dried in an omnidirectional manner, and the device is simple in structure.

technical field [0001] The invention relates to the field of capacitor production, in particular to a high-efficiency drying device for capacitor shells. Background technique [0002] Capacitors, also known as capacitors, are devices that hold charges. They are widely used in electronic power equipment, and they play a role in blocking, coupling, bypassing, and energy conversion of circuits. The capacitor is composed of the shell, the end cover on the shell, the capacitor medium placed in the shell and other accessories. After a series of steps such as extrusion, molding, edge trimming, and flanging, the capacitor shell has a lot of powder or residue left on the surface. These things need to be cleaned up to facilitate subsequent production and avoid capacitors. Some dust remains inside, which affects the use effect of the capacitor, so the capacitor shell needs further cleaning, and after the cleaning is completed, the capacitor needs to be dried.
